      Stevenson is probably more of a super middleweight anyway. He spent much of his career there. He was just presented a good opportunity against Dawson and moved up to take. And when he won, he stayed in the division, he could probably still be fighting as a super middleweight. Recent examples that come to mind are Pacquiao moving from 122 to 126 to fight Barrera. Sergio Martinez did it to fight Pavlik. And to an extent, Cotto did it against Martinez. Difference between Cotto and the other guys is that he didn’t legitimately stay in the division.

                    While I don't disagree that Stevenson is a good fighter, I disagree on the level of his opposition. Dawson and Bika were washed up at that point, Top Dog Williams isn't very good and neither is Sukotskiy. Boone is a tricky gatekeeper but he loses almost as much as he wins. I will give him Fonfara I and Bellew as good wins.

                    Jack has been dropped and stopped before and not by murderous punchers either. Adonis could stretch Badou early or his power could make Jack apprehensive. If neither happens then Jack will bring it and attack that body. Its a compelling match and I will be watching.
